A complete roofing substitute is simply what it seems like: full. Unlike re-roofing, which entails laying down a brand-new layer of shingles in addition to your old roof covering product, a complete roofing system substitute includes detaching every layer of your roof covering and replacing it. This is why some companies call it a "tear-off" roofing system.
They act like a coat of mail, losing water and particles, and maintaining all the underlying layers of your roof covering completely dry and devoid of damage. Asphalt shingles are the most common type of roof covering roof shingles utilized on property homes, yet you have several roof covering alternatives to pick from. Decking: The outdoor decking is a significant layer of defense for your home, typically including a series of level boards connected to the joists or trusses.

Underlayment: This essential layer goes in-between the outdoor decking and the roof shingles. Underlayment is a waterproof or waterproof layer attached straight to the roofing system deck, and supplies an extra degree of security from extreme weather condition. Blinking: A thin yet vital roof element, blinking is utilized to route water away from prone areas of the roofing, particularly where a section of roof covering meets an upright surface like a wall or smokeshaft.
